  2. So, I finally made time to spend on my Zed. The accessory relay was to blame, I had a spare, and replacing it sorted all the electrical issues with the left pod, mirrors etc. Happy days! I had come across a long-lost spark tester and compression tester, as expected though the spark tester wasn’t long enough. I moved onto the compression tester, expecting all to be generally ok, these are the results, they were not ok – Dry Test Cylinder 1 5.5 bar, 80 psi Cylinder 2 3.5 bar, 50 psi Cylinder 3 5.5 bar, 80 psi Cylinder 4 2.0 bar, 30 psi Cylinder 5 5 bar, 70 psi Cylinder 6 3.5 bar, 50 psi Wet Test Cylinder 1 5.5 bar, 80 psi Cylinder 2 5 bar, 75 psi Cylinder 3 5 bar, 75 psi Cylinder 4 5 bar, 75 psi Cylinder 5 7.5 bar, 105 psi Cylinder 6 5 bar, 75 psi It’s pretty disastrous, not at all what I was expecting, but it explains why the engine wont run. I just wondered what you all thought of these results? My understanding is it points to piston rings….even though the car used to run and drive, but has been standing for years, only turned over occasionally. It should be noted that I just fitted new cylinder heads, with new gaskets. The heads were in need of a major clean when I got them, and I scrubbed them well. When I fitted them, I used the correct torque, and bolting method. My initial thoughts was that the cylinder head gaskets aren’t sealed properly, but they must be.

  16. Hey, I'll admit I didn't have the lower timing belt cover off at this point, so hadn't seen the tensioner, but the belt was tight, and the intake / exhaust pulleys were all still aligned. When I removed the lower intake the belt didn't move, I'm guessing it should have now, as the tensioner should have adjusted. I don't think it did, it cant have, nothing moved. I marked the belt to be on the safe side (and that turned out well...) so knew there had been no movement the next day. Everything indicated that there had been no movement, so I bolted the lower intake manifold back into position, and all seemed fine, everything was still aligned and I was happy. I hadn't seen the crank at this point admittedly, but I figured if all was tight and aligned up top, then all has to be good down below. Clearly I shouldn't have taken that risk. When I got the shield off today the tensioner gap was non existent, I understand now that it should be 4mm. This was post presumed slippage however, so the damage was already done. The timing belt is perfectly aligned everywhere (not that it matters now), I started with the dotted line on the left and I worked around all the pulleys, using bull-dog clips to keep the belt in position, and finally did the crank, which did need rotating a little. I got the belt onto the tensioner, and it was all back in place, I then levered the tensioner forward, tightened the bolts up, all looked good, although the tensioner will need adjusting back to 4mm. I'd REALLY hoped that once everything was aligned again, that with some luck, the engine would rotate fine and all would be well. Unfortunately I had no luck, and probably deserve this.
